Who makes a Rodeo?

The Rodeo is made by Isuzu Motors Limited.


The Rodeo is a mid-size SUV produced by Isuzu, a Japanese automaker. It was introduced in 1990 and was manufactured in two generations through the early 2000s for markets worldwide, including North America.

Manufacturer and model basics



  • Manufacturer: Isuzu Motors Limited (Japan)

  • Type: Mid-size SUV

  • First generation: 1990–1997

  • Second generation: 1998–2004

  • North American presence: Sold in the U.S. and Canada through the 1990s and into the early 2000s
